Default Detroit Citizens Raise money for Statue of Civic Son

The people of Detroit raised $50K to help pay for a Statue of one of Detroit's favourite sons.....

Quote:
Residents of Detroit have raised more than $50,000 to build a statue of one of the city's favourite sons - Robocop. Robocop spawned three movies and a TV series



The idea of of celebrating the character from the popular movie trilogy was sparked by a tweet directed at Detroit mayor Dave Bing.
"Philadelphia has a a statue of Rocky, Robocop would kick Rocky's butt. He's a great ambassador for Detroit," MT tweeted.
